Conservative Numbers Trial:
I set to only 3.71
I'd been marking total on-time using Battery Graph for the last couple charges. First one was 2:40 before shut down. Second one was 2:45 before shut down. Both occured over 4-6 days, occasional WiFi use (2 or 3 times at less than 10 minutes), mostly PIM and Docs To Go. Slightly underclocked to 354 to get rid of the whine (although Speedy clocks it at 361). Lots of SolFree solotaire lately, for some reason. It seems to suck juice, too. SolFree and WebPro seem to be the only programs that after quitting them, I get a bounce in battery. I know this is normal with WebPro - anybody else find this with SolFree?
Anyway, at a conservative 3.71, I went from the 2:45 up to 3:15 before shut down. Not spectacular, but a sizeable gain for such a small tweak. Obviously there was no data loss.
Even though it sounds like 3.60 is the magic number, I'll go with 3.65 next charge just get the data.
